Submission statement

The tech ethics organization Center for AI and Digital Policy (CAIDP) has asked the Federal Trade Commission to investigate OpenAI for violating consumer protection regulations. CAIDP alleges that OpenAI's AI text generation tools are "biased, deceptive, and dangerous to public safety."

CAIDP's complaint raises concerns about the potential threat of OpenAI's GPT-4 generated text model, which was announced in mid-March. It warns of the potential for GPT-4 to generate malware and highly personalized propaganda, and the risk that biased training data could lead to ingrained stereotypes or unfair racial and gender preferences in employment.

The complaint also cites significant privacy failures in the OpenAI product interface, such as a recent bug that exposed OpenAI ChatGPT records and potentially ChatGPT and subscribers' payment details.

CAIDP seeks to hold OpenAI liable for violating Section 5 of the FTC Act, which prohibits unfair and deceptive trade practices. The complaint alleges that OpenAI knowingly released GPT-4 to the public for commercial use despite the risks, including potential bias and harmful behavior.
